WIU Agriculture Students Earn National Honors at PAS Conference

MACOMB, IL - - Western Illinois University School of Agriculture (Ag) celebrates the success of members of the WIU Professional Agricultural Students (PAS) organization who competed at the 2026 National PAS Conference, held March 9-12 at Chateau on the Lake in Branson, MO.

The PAS is a student-led organization that helps members develop the skills needed to succeed in the workplace. Through competitive events, members gain hands-on experience and are prepared for careers across the agriculture industry.

WIU students earned multiple top honors at the national level, including:

Laila Beck and Jayson Kuzniar were named National Cornhole Champions.
Adam Vail earned first place in Career Planning – Agricultural Education Systems and third place in Individual Prepared Speaking.
Laila Beck also placed third in Individual Agronomy Specialist.
Olivia Brodbeck earned second place in Individual Precision Agriculture.
Amanda Niemann earned first place in Career Progress – Agricultural Education Systems and third place in Agricultural Education.
Ben Wamsley placed third in Agricultural Marketing and Communication.
Jayson Kuzniar placed tenth in Individual Agronomy Specialist.
The Agronomy Team, consisting of Laila Beck, Jayson Kuzniar, and Adam Vail, placed fifth overall.
The College Bowl Team, consisting of Laila Beck, Jayson Kuzniar, Olivia Brodbeck, Adam Vail, and Ben Wamsley, placed among the top five teams.

Students representing WIU at the conference included Amanda Niemann, Olivia Brodbeck, Adam Vail, Jayson Kuzniar, Laila Beck and Ben Wamsley.

These accomplishments highlight the WIU's dedication to preparing future leaders for the agricultural industry.
